AI Personalization and Digital Security

  • Sam Altman’s vision for ChatGPT to remember users’ life histories

  • In a groundbreaking vision articulated by Sam Altman, CEO of OpenAI, the future of ChatGPT promises a remarkable degree of personalization. As of mid-May 2025, Altman envisions a version of ChatGPT capable of documenting and recalling every aspect of a user’s life history. This includes not just previous conversations, but also emails, reading materials, and other personal data, thereby creating a comprehensive context for interactions. He emphasized the potential for ChatGPT to serve as an all-knowing life advisor, increasingly seen by younger users in their 20s and 30s as a personal assistant for decision-making.

  • Altman’s proposal involves utilizing a massive context reserve, described as 'trillion tokens of context', which would allow the AI to build an intricate understanding of individual users. This development reflects a larger trend within the tech community where AI systems are designed to integrate and make use of user-generated data continuously. Such capabilities could lead to the automation of routine tasks like scheduling maintenance or managing personal projects. However, this ambitious integration raises significant concerns regarding data privacy and security, as it poses risks of misuse by corporate entities or even malicious actors.

  • The security implications of such AI-driven personalization cannot be overstated. Users may feel uneasy about a technology that intimately knows personal details about their lives, especially with the growing awareness of data breaches and privacy violations. Reports indicate that while such systems offer enhanced user experiences, they accompany the problem of reliance on potentially deceptive technologies. As Altman noted, consumers' trust in a 'Big Tech' company to handle their most private information may waver amid fears of exploitation and unauthorized data access.

  • FBI alert on AI-driven voice cloning scams targeting officials

  • The FBI has recently issued a poignant alert regarding the rise of affluent cyber scams employing AI-generated voice and text messages to impersonate senior U.S. government officials. This scheme, noted to have been active since April 2025, involves sophisticated tactics where bad actors send tailored messages designed to deceive high-profile individuals into disclosing sensitive information or account access. In these instances, attackers typically initiate contact by mimicking trusted figures to build rapport before redirecting victims to malicious platforms under their control.

  • The FBI’s guidance to the public highlights the critical necessity for verification when encountering communication that claims to derive from government officials. The risks range from simple identity theft to potentially more extensive breaches where compromised accounts could facilitate broader scams. The agency has outlined methods of critical awareness, urging individuals to scrutinize phone numbers, message contents, URLs, and even the tone of voice in phone calls.

  • Given the sophistication of AI-generated impersonations, it is paramount for users to remain vigilant. Techniques such as 'smishing' (malicious text messaging) and 'vishing' (voice phishing) are being employed, leveraging social engineering tactics to mislead victims. The FBI cautions that these scams mirror traditional spear phishing methods, but with a contemporary twist that utilizes advanced AI to generate believable audio and text. The unfolding circumstances signify an alarming trend that underscores the immediate need for robust digital security measures, including two-factor authentication and the use of secret passphrases among families and close contacts.

Open Digital Standards

  • 20th anniversary of the Open Document Format

  • The Open Document Format (ODF) recently celebrated its 20th anniversary, a significant milestone highlighting its role in promoting open, vendor-neutral file formats. The introduction of ODF was a response to the overwhelming dominance of proprietary software, particularly Microsoft's Office suite, which heavily influenced how documents were created, stored, and exchanged. Initiated by Sun Microsystems, ODF was designed to enable interoperability across different office applications, minimizing dependency on any one vendor's proprietary solution. The formal approval of ODF as a standard occurred on May 1, 2005, after extensive refinement processes by the OASIS Technical Committee. However, despite its recognition as an official standard, the adoption of ODF faced considerable challenges. Microsoft introduced its rival Open XML formats, further complicating the landscape of document management. Notably, while various government entities and institutions advocated for ODF adoption — such as the UK government in 2014 for sharing and collaboration — widespread consumer acceptance remained limited, largely due to inertia favoring Microsoft formats. Eliane Domingos, Chair of the Document Foundation, aptly characterized ODF as a symbol of user autonomy, emphasizing its significance in a market increasingly dominated by proprietary ecosystems. The Document Foundation's stewardship of LibreOffice, a prominent fork of OpenOffice, illustrates ongoing efforts to sustain ODF as a viable alternative for businesses and consumers seeking control over their content. In recognition of this anniversary, the Document Foundation announced plans to publish a range of resources, including presentations and retrospective documents detailing the history and unique features of ODF. These efforts seek to illuminate the importance of open standards in fostering a competitive software ecosystem and in protecting users' rights against exploitative practices of dominant tech companies.

  • Impact of vendor-neutral file formats on software ecosystems

  • The advent of vendor-neutral file formats such as ODF has significantly impacted software ecosystems by promoting interoperability and user choice. By providing standardized formats for document creation and exchange, ODF facilitates seamless collaboration among diverse software applications and platforms. This capability is crucial in an increasingly interconnected digital landscape, where professionals frequently collaborate across various operating systems and software environments. Historically, the dominance of proprietary formats restricted users to specific software ecosystems, leading to compatibility issues and restricted access to data. ODF emerged not only as a technical specification but also as a philosophical stance against such exclusivity. Its widespread endorsement by governments and organizations worldwide underscores the recognition of open standards as essential for innovation and user empowerment. Additionally, vendor-neutral formats like ODF are instrumental in safeguarding users against vendor lock-in, allowing individuals and organizations to switch software providers without fearing data loss or extensive resource investment in file conversion processes. This flexibility fosters a more competitive market, encouraging software developers to innovate and improve their offerings, knowing that users retain the option to migrate their data without significant barriers. The ongoing evolution and adoption of ODF demonstrate the necessity of establishing robust open standards in today’s digital age, ensuring that user rights and choices remain at the forefront of technology development.

Innovations in Materials and Robotics

  • Seashell-inspired shock-adaptive materials

  • Researchers have made significant strides in developing a new type of protective material inspired by the natural shock-absorbing properties of seashells. The layered synthetic material, designed by a collaborative team from the University of Illinois Urbana-Champaign and the Technical University of Denmark, leverages the unique structural properties of nacre, or mother-of-pearl, found in the interiors of certain mollusk shells. Designed to react adaptively to impacts, this material features individual layers that collaborate to absorb shocks more effectively than traditional materials. The engineering team, led by Professor Shelly Zhang and Professor Ole Sigmund, reported that instead of merely mimicking nature's methods, they programmed these layers to operate collectively, enabling precision in their response to force. This revolutionary approach allows the material to 'buckles' in a controlled manner under stress, shifting how energy is absorbed during an impact. Their findings were published on May 16, 2025, in the journal Science Advances, suggesting potential applications in automotive and wearable technology, where enhanced safety and smarter design are paramount. The material could significantly improve the design of car bumpers and protective gear, making them both safer and more efficient.

  • Low-cost centipede robots for vineyard and farm weeding

  • A groundbreaking development in agricultural robotics has emerged with the design of low-cost centipede robots developed by the startup Ground Control Robotics (GCR). As of May 17, 2025, these robots, inspired by the natural locomotion of centipedes, are engineered to navigate the challenging uneven terrain found in vineyards and farms. Their innovative design integrates a sensor-equipped head followed by multiple identical segments powered by motors that control their movement. This unique configuration allows the robots to mimic serpentine movements, enabling them to traverse complex landscapes without causing damage to crops. Daniel Goldman, director of the CRAB Lab at Georgia Institute of Technology, highlighted how these robots leverage a cable-driven mechanism that transitions from rigid to flexible motion, facilitating their movement across various terrains without any advanced control systems. This robotic technology is particularly well-suited for agricultural applications where precision weeding is essential, as it can operate effectively in environments that traditional machinery might disrupt. Ground Control Robotics’ centipede robots could mark a shift toward more sustainable farming practices, allowing for efficient and careful management of crops.

Nutrition Science for Healthy Aging

  • Association between high-fiber, quality carbohydrate intake and cognitive/physical health in later life

  • Recent research spearheaded by scientists at the Jean Mayer USDA Human Nutrition Research Center on Aging at Tufts University has highlighted a significant connection between carbohydrate quality, particularly fiber-rich options, and health outcomes in older adults. Notably, a comprehensive study involving 47, 512 women from the long-standing Nurses' Health Study indicates that those who consumed a diet rich in high-quality carbohydrates—such as whole grains, fruits, vegetables, and legumes—exhibited better cognitive and physical health in their later years, defined as reaching age 70 free from major chronic diseases.

  • The study, published in JAMA Network Open just a day before this report on May 16, 2025, analyzed dietary data collected from participants starting in 1984 and 1986. This time frame coincides with a critical period in women's midlife when dietary choices begin to have a long-term impact. The researchers revealed that women whose diets were higher in quality carbohydrates had a 31% higher likelihood of achieving what the researchers termed 'healthy aging', as opposed to those whose diets were predominantly made up of low-quality carbohydrates, which were linked to a 13% lower likelihood of such outcomes.

  • The researchers characterized 'healthy aging' as not only surviving to age 70 but doing so while being free from eleven major chronic diseases, maintaining good mental health, and having unimpaired physical and cognitive functions. For example, participants' physical health was assessed in terms of their ability to perform daily tasks, including carrying groceries and climbing stairs. Interestingly, the study found that only a modest number of participants succeeded in reaching age 70 without chronic diseases, illuminating the importance of early dietary interventions.

  • This recent study importantly emphasizes that dietary fiber, particularly from fruits and vegetables, is instrumental in promoting longevity and health. Resistant starches found in legumes and whole grains contribute to this by ensuring stable blood glucose levels and promoting satiety, which may prevent overconsumption. Nutrition experts advocate for individuals to incorporate a diverse range of fruits and at least two servings daily into their diets for optimal health outcomes in aging populations.

  • In summary, high-fiber diets rich in quality carbohydrates not only help manage chronic disease risks but also bolster cognitive function and overall quality of life as individuals age. These findings underscore the critical role that nutrition plays in fostering healthy aging and the potential interventions that can be employed to enhance quality of life among aging demographics.

Biological and Philosophical Insights

  • New integrative paradigms in domestication research

  • A recent special issue of the Proceedings of the Royal Society B has introduced transformative insights into the study of domestication, challenging established conceptions in both biology and the social sciences. This issue, titled 'Shifting Paradigms Towards Integrated Perspectives in Domestication Studies, ' brings together experts from various fields—including archaeology, evolutionary biology, and plant science—to offer a comprehensive reevaluation of domestication as a complex and multi-faceted process rather than a singular historical event. Key themes emerging from this work emphasize that domestication is not restricted to widely recognized crops and livestock, such as wheat and sheep, but includes a diverse array of plants and animals, showcasing the interrelatedness of ecological, technological, and social factors across different historical contexts. The contributors to this volume explore less-studied species and how domestication manifests variably based on local ecological conditions and human cultural practices. A significant highlight is Dr. Rita Dal Martello's exhaustive analysis of cereal grain metrics, spanning from the 9th millennium BCE to the present. Her research reveals independent evolutionary trends and challenges the linear narratives historically used to describe agricultural progress, underlining the intricate dynamics between human choices and environmental constraints in shaping domesticated traits. Furthermore, a critical examination of the definitions surrounding domestication has emerged, advocating for a broader conceptual understanding that recognizes the incremental and often unconscious nature of these processes.

  • Influence of medieval scholastic philosophy on modern thought

  • The engagement with medieval scholastic philosophy offers potent reflections on its substantial impact on contemporary thought. Commonly portrayed as a stagnation period for scientific inquiry, the Middle Ages actually nurtured a rigorous analytical approach that laid foundational principles for future scientific exploration. Central figures such as St. Augustine and St. Thomas Aquinas significantly shaped philosophical discourse by integrating theological insights with a burgeoning understanding of the natural world. While often viewed through a lens of constraints, medieval scholars employed rigorous methods for inquiry and reasoning, challenging preconceived notions about nature and existence. The principle of the uniformity of natural laws and the quest for truth in representation, both championed by scholastics, continue to resonate strongly in today’s philosophical discussions. Their works demonstrate a nuanced understanding of the interplay between faith, reason, and the material world, signaling an enduring legacy that informs not only philosophy but also the development of the scientific method in modern times.

Theology and Transhumanism in the Digital Age

  • Pope Leo XIV’s engagement with AI in shaping papal identity

  • Pope Leo XIV, who assumed his papal name in early 2025, articulated that the challenges posed by artificial intelligence necessitate a proactive and thoughtful response from the Church. He drew parallels between the current AI revolution and the earlier industrial revolutions addressed in Pope Leo XIII's 'Rerum Novarum'. His papacy is marked by an understanding that AI can bring significant changes, not only to socio-economic structures but also to the spiritual and ethical dimensions of human existence. In this context, the pope has called for a balanced discourse that acknowledges both the benefits and potential ethical pitfalls inherent in AI development. The insights provided by artificial intelligence could play a role in shaping ecclesiastical decisions while ensuring that these technologies serve humanity without undermining the core values of human dignity and identity. This engagement suggests a willingness to integrate contemporary technology within theological frameworks, making the Church relevant in modern discussions of morality and ethics.
